Brand invests in through-the-line Autumn baking campaign

Lyle’s Golden Syrup today announces the launch of Celebrity Frightened Chef, a Halloween-themed cooking show featuring Zoe Salmon, ex-Blue Peter presenter and star of BBC Celebrity Masterchef.

The unique cookery show, set in the most haunted house in the UK, is part of a wider 360 Autumn baking campaign encompassing PR, in-store and branding activity that aims to broaden the brand’s appeal to a wider market including younger bakers.

Celebrity Frightened Chef, which airs today at www.lylesgoldensyrup.com/trickortreacle documents Zoe Salmon struggling to cook seasonal recipes with unexplained noises and apparitions appearing around her.

Today’s announcement follows the launch of the limited edition Black Treacle tin, Trick or Treacle’ – designed for Halloween – which hit shelves at the beginning of October. The limited edition rebrand is set to appeal to a younger audience, rejuvenate the brand and educate consumers on how to incorporate Lyle’s syrups into their cooking and baking in inspiring ways.
